Output dd40fc70cbd131e6d7786351d6b43b8cabf73f1b68c286a18c528a0253f968e0:8

value
55709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dec3fc6744a14018a2fbcf63d2eeef6b95f058e OP_EQUAL
address
3BiEbL6V1n3k1uq4pgWPyNWFDZBYQ49q74
transaction
dd40fc70cbd131e6d7786351d6b43b8cabf73f1b68c286a18c528a0253f968e0
confirmations
167568
spent
true